WebApr 23, 2024 · The MLA allows BLM to waive, suspend, or reduce the rental or minimum royalty on federal leases based on the same criteria as royalty rate reductions. See 30 U.S.C. § 209; 43 C.F.R. § 3103.4-1(a). The Interim Royalty Reduction Guidance, however, does not address modifications of rentals or minimum royalties.

WebTo keep America competitive, a ten-year, industry-wide royalty rate of two percent will be established on January 1, 2024 for all existing and future federal soda ash and sodium bicarbonate leases.
